ISL 2020-21 | Pep Guardiola congratulates Mumbai City FC for winning ISL Shield

 

Manchester City boss Pep Guardiola on Monday congratulated City Football Group owned sister-club Mumbai City FC for topping the league stage of the Indian Super League.

Mumbai City won their final League stage match against ATK Mohun Bagan by a 2-0 scoreline to win the ISL Shield. They finished with 40 points at the end of the league stage, which was equal to ATK Mohun Bagan’s points tally but the Islanders won the league stage on account of better goal difference. As a result, the Islanders also became only the second Indian club to qualify for the group stage of the AFC Champions League.

Guardiola described Sergio Lobera and Mumbai City’s success as an incredible achievement.

“It is part of the CFG family,” Guardiola said in a press conference.

“Now comes the play-off. Hopefully, they can do well,” he added.

“Congratulations to all the people. Every league is tricky and when you win it is well deserved,” he said.

Mumbai City’s forwards played a great role in their success this season. Adam Le Fondre finsihed as the top scorer for the side with 11 goals to his name, whereas the likes of Bartholomew Ogbeche and Bipin Singh scored eight and five goals respectively as well. Bipin was a revelation this season as he supplied four assists in addition to his five goals as well.

Hugo Boumous was the creator-in-chief from the midfield as he amassed a total of seven assists and scored two goals himself as well. Centre back Mourtada Fall played a crucial role too as he contributed with three goals to the side.

City Football Group bought 65 per cent stake in the ISL club in 2019. The majority stakeholders of CFG are Abu Dhabi United Group.

As far as things for Manchester City are considered, they look all set to win the Premier League title this season as they have a 12-point lead at the top of the table from second-placed Manchester United with just 12 games to go.
